Najväčšia drevená socha na Slovensku sa nachádza v Starej Bystrici. Má podobu sediacej Sedembolestnej Panny Márie - patrónky Slovenska. Na jeho realizácii sa podieľalo viacero architektov, rezbárov, technikov, stavbárov, kamenárov zo Slovenska a Českej republiky.
Vo výklenkoch orloja je umiestnených šesť bronzových plastík: z najstaršieho obdobia je to knieža Pribina, kráľ Svätopluk, z 19. storočia sú to kodifikátori slovenského jazyka Anton Bernolák a Ľudovít Štúr, z 20. storočia je to Milan Rastislav Štefánik a Andrej Hlinka.
Sedem sôch slovenských apoštolov vytesal z topoľového dreva ľudový rezbár Peter Kuník z Tvrdošína. Ide o svätcov, ktorých osudy boli spojené so Slovenskom: sv. Cyril, sv. Metod, sv. Andrej-Svorad, sv. Beňadik, sv. Gorazd, sv. Bystrík a sv. Vojtech.
Srdcom orloja je tzv. astroláb, teda ciferník s astronomickými údajmi. Práve astroláb robí zo Slovenského orloja v Starej Bystrici jediný a prvý orloj na Slovensku.
Farebnosť hlavnej dosky astrolábu je daná fázami dňa:čierna noc, červená úsvit, bledomodrá deň-obzor, červená súmrak. Ručička so slnkom sa pohybuje po týchto poliach podľa toho, kde sa reálne slnko nachádza. Hlavná doska astrolábu je ďalej delená zlatými lemovkami, ktoré označujú rovník, obratník raka, obratník kozorožca a tzv. miestny poludník, teda úsečku priamky, ktorá ukazuje kedy je slnko najvyššie na oblohe nad Starou Bystricou. Orloj v Starej Bystrici tak ako jediný z jestvujúcich orlojov na svete ukazuje tzv. pravý slnečný čas.
Okrem toho astroláb ukazuje polohu mesiaca na oblohe, fázy mesiaca a polohu slnka v znamení zverokruhu. Na vonkajšom okraji je tzv. kalendárna doska, ktorá má 366 dielov a každý deň sa otočí o jeden diel. Významné slovenské sviatky a pamätné dni sú na kalendárnej doske označené červenou hviezdičkou.
Vo vežičke orloja sú umiestnené dva zvony. Jeden zvon odbíja čas, druhý zvon vytvára zvukovú kulisu počas promenády apoštolov.

The National Park of Malá Fatra is situated in the westernmost Slovak high mountains Malá Fatra. Gorges, rock peaks and an attractive ridge tour are among its attractions.
The village Štefanová with numerous buildings built in traditional style is situated in the north-west of Slovakia at the foothill of the mountain Veľký Rozsutec (1,610 m).
The only access road to the Vrátna valley, the most attractive part of the Malá Fatra Mts. is from the village Terchová. The Vrátna valley has four points of access: Tiesňavy, Stará dolina, Nová dolina and Starý dvor.
In Kysuce village Korňa, you will not find any oil tycoons who would become rich thanks to „black gold“. However, you can find there the unique oil spring, which is the only preserved spring among similar smaller oil surface outflows in the central Europe. The picturesque village of Korňa is situated in the Čadca district, near the town of Turzovka, in Beskydy Mountains.

The narrow gauge Historic Forest Railway in Vychylovka in the Kysuce region in northwestern Slovakia is a technological masterpiece of world prominence operating in the area that divides the Kysuce and Orava regions.
The most famous highwayman, Juraj Jánošík, was born in the mountainous village of Terchová in the north-west of Slovakia. The inhabitants of Terchová had a statue of their native made to guard the entrance to the Vrátna valley.
The Kysuce Museum in Čadca is a regional museum focused on national history and geography. At the same time, it is also a specialized museum with Slovakia-wide competence concerning the documentation of the development of forest railways in Slovakia for museum purposes.

Hrad sa vyníma na lesnom pozadí v Domašínskom meandri Váhu povyše hradu Strečno. Na Považí patril tento hrad medzi najstaršie. Pôvodne sa nazýval hrad Varín. Svoj dnešný názov "Starý hrad" získal po výstavbe a sprevádzkovaní hradu Strečno.
Fierce fights for the strategic gap of the Váh and the mountain range Malá Fatra near Strečno in the north-west of Slovakia took place between the German army and the partisans of the Slovak National Uprising (SNP). A memorial was built on the hill Zvonica to commemorate the dead heroes.
